Annotation: A one-of-a-kind compendium of popular fiction from a bygone era
Dime novels as fundamentally American as baseball and jazzwere an inexpensive and inexhaustible source of popular entertainment for millions of Americans in the late nineteenth and early twentieth centuries. The five novels in this unique anthology are classic examples of the form, which encompassed Westerns, early science fiction, detective and mystery yarns, and Revolutionary War historicals. From the handsome gambler Dashing Diamond Dick and the daring inventor in Over the Andes with Frank Reade, Jr., in His New Air-Ship to the mythic baseball player in Frank Merriwells Finish, here are some of the most valiant heroes and notorious rogues in the pantheon. Read together, these novels are fascinating time capsules from a young nation in love with its larger-than-life characters.
